Abstract
This IDC study reviews the performance of the Windows COE market during 2007 and provides a forecast for Windows products available in this market segment through 2012. Included in this study are five-year forecasts for Windows COEs, including new license shipments and installed base by SKU.
"Windows Vista was more successful in consumer environments during 2007 than the trade press gives it credit for, but the business community has been, as expected, slow to adopt Windows Vista. We believe the sluggish adoption is caused more by the maturation of the client PC than by concerns over Windows Vista specifically," said Al Gillen, research VP, System Software at IDC. "Looking forward, we expect that 2008 will mark the beginning of a much stronger adoption curve for Windows Vista on the business side, especially now that Windows Server 2008 has launched."
